My mustang is a pain in the ass to keep looking good , special soap for the 2500 dollar ceramic coat job , a spray and wipe container the size of windex bottle that cost  18.00 , just a nightmare to keep looking good .

Spends more time in garage  , not a daily , I had lots of mods done to it , biggest being super charger , just shy of a 1000 HP 

I havent had ceramic professionally done. Its very expensive, and even if it lasts years, I dont think it pays for itself. 

I wash mine pretty much weekly. I have used the graphene ceramic wax (which should last about 6 months), and the car soap I use is turtle wax ceramic hybrid car wash. So there is SiO2 in the car soap. It basically reapplies a ceramic coat weekly.

That soap is like 18 dollars a bottle and I get a bunch of washes out of it. The graphene ceramic wax was 35 dollars and you get about 10 uses out of it. I wont need to buy that again for about 5 years.

I feel like I can keep my car looking clean with a great gloss and shine for many years at a  far cheaper cost than a professional ceramic job. I also think at least to the naked eye that the visual results are the same. The only difference is how long it lasts. And doing the work yourself, which I enjoy.
